You (or anything) can only float if the force of gravity pulling down is exactly balanced by some other force pushing up. In a fluid there's a force called buoyancy pushing up on anything in the fluid, the strength of which is equal to the weight of fluid 'displaced' (the fluid that would be in that space if the thing weren't there). The cool thing is that buoyancy is actually generated BY gravity acting on all the other fluid and is always in the opposite direction to gravity (up).
